Overview

Belt Conveyors built to your application

A belt conveyor is the simplest way to move light and medium parts, cartons and sub-assemblies between operations at a controlled pace. Where it goes wrong is in the details: working height that forces operators to stoop, a belt that cannot be tracked, or a drive that cannot hold speed under load.

We size the belt, drive and structure from the actual product weight per metre, the required rate and how operators or machines interact with it, then design guarding, side guides and take-up so the conveyor runs for years with routine maintenance.

Variants

Types of belt conveyors we build

Flat belt conveyor

General transport between stations, inspection and packing.

Cleated incline conveyor

Lifts loose parts or bulk between levels without slipping.

Assembly line belt

Paced belt with working height, tool rails, bins and lighting for operators.

Packing & dispatch belt

Accumulation, weighing and carton handling at end of line.

Specification

Technical specification

Typical build parameters. Final specifications are fixed with you at design freeze.

Belt typesPVC, PU, food-grade, cleated, anti-static, high-grip
FrameMS powder-coated, SS 304 for washdown, aluminium profile for light duty
DriveGeared motor with VFD; head, centre or tail drive as layout allows
HeightFixed or adjustable legs, set to the operator task
AccessoriesSide guides, stoppers, photo-eyes, diverters, work trays, lighting
ControlsLocal start/stop, line PLC integration, E-stop and pull-cord options
OptionsIncline/decline sections, nose-over, weighing section, inspection lighting

FAQ

Belt Conveyors: common questions

What length and width of belt conveyor can you build?

We build to your layout — from short 2 m transfer conveyors to long multi-section lines. Width is driven by the product footprint plus clearance; typical assembly belts run 300–800 mm wide.

Can the speed be adjusted?

Yes. A VFD lets you set and lock line speed, and the conveyor can be run continuously or indexed against a station cycle.

Do you supply food-grade or ESD belts?

Yes — food-grade PU/PVC belts with stainless frames, and anti-static belts for electronics assembly.
